Pacific Linguistics, Research School of Pacific and Asian Studies, Australian National University, 1979. — xi + 163 p. — ISBN 0858831872.Tigak is an Austronesian language in the New Ireland Province of Papua New Guinea. It is spoken by just over 4000 people living in the northern part of the mainland of New Ireland (extending about 30 miles south of Kavieng). There are four main dialects, Central, Southern, Island and Western. This study is primarily concerned with the Central dialect.
